Echelberry— Whiteman*i*.%■Mary Jane Echelberry and Robert W. Whiteman exchanged rings before the altar of the Presbyterian Church in Plymouth April 24 at 2:30 p m The Rev. Bruce Williams and the Rev. David Root officiated.Mr. and Mrs. Kenneth Echelberry, RD 1, Plymouth, are the parents of the bride and Mrs. Dorothy Whiteman, Columbus, and the late Mr. Whiteman are the parents of the bridegroom.Mrs. Thomas Rish, sister of the bride, was matron of honor. Bridesmaids were Mrs. Robert Hall, Mrs. Mike Van Vlerah, Miss Kimberly Chronister and Miss Angela Echelberry. Miss Lovette Conkel was flower girl.Larry Conkel stood beside the bridegroom as best man. Kevin Echelberry, brother of the bride, Thomas Rish, Shelby Starkey and David Daiiey were ushers and Jason Rish carried the rings.Wedding guests celebrated the event during a reception at the American Legion after which the newlyweds departed ior the Pocono Mountains. They will live at 2746 Ruhl Ave„ Columbus.The bride is a graduate of Plymouth High School and the Ohio State School of Cosmetology. She is employed by Skagg’s Beauty Shop in Columbus.
